Laser hair removal directs light energy toward pigment in eligible hair follicles. Hair grows in cycles, so a series is required to reach follicles during treatable growth phases.

Hair colour, skin tone, hormonal factors, area, device settings, and prior hair-removal methods all influence response. Fine, light, grey, white, or red hair may respond poorly.

Before you book

Candidacy, preparation, and care after.

01

Who it may suit

Best candidacy depends on contrast between hair pigment and skin, device capabilities, medical history, medications, tanning, and the treatment area.

02

How to prepare

Avoid tanning and unapproved light-sensitive products, shave as directed, and do not wax or tweeze during the treatment series unless the clinic advises otherwise.

03

Downtime & response

Temporary redness, warmth, swelling around follicles, sensitivity, or pigment change can occur. Sun exposure increases risk.

04

Aftercare

Cool and protect the skin as directed, avoid heat and friction temporarily, and use diligent broad-spectrum sun protection on exposed areas.

Your questions, answered

Laser Hair Removal FAQ.

01Why are multiple sessions needed?

Only follicles in certain growth phases respond at a given session, so treatment is spaced across several cycles.

03Can every hair colour be treated?

No. Hair with little pigment, including white, grey, and some very light or red hair, may not respond well.

04Can I wax between sessions?

Waxing and tweezing remove the target from the follicle and are usually avoided during a series. Follow the clinic’s instructions.

05Is the reduction permanent?

Laser is generally described as long-term hair reduction. Hormones and new follicle activity can make maintenance necessary.
